Tag

SCTA World Finals

Browsing

Watch out Mission Motors, electric motorcycle manufacturer Lightning Motorcycles is gunning for you. This week at the SCTA World Finals at the Bonneville Salt Flats, the Lightning’s pre-production prototype set a speed of 166.388 mph. While only completing a single pass down the salt flats, and not a return journey to make an official speed entry, 166 mph is still an impressive mark, and has provided the company with crucial information as they get ready to go commercial in 2010. Photos and more after the jump.